| connect(SocketAddress, SocketAddress, ChannelPromise) |  | 0% |  | 0% | 6 | 6 | 18 | 18 | 1 | 1 |
| finishConnect() |  | 0% |  | 0% | 6 | 6 | 14 | 14 | 1 | 1 |
| shutdownInput(boolean) |  | 0% |  | 0% | 5 | 5 | 15 | 15 | 1 | 1 |
| doFinishConnect() |  | 0% |  | 0% | 3 | 3 | 8 | 8 | 1 | 1 |
| clearEpollIn0() |  | 0% |  | 0% | 3 | 3 | 8 | 8 | 1 | 1 |
| fulfillConnectPromise(ChannelPromise, boolean) |  | 0% |  | 0% | 5 | 5 | 10 | 10 | 1 | 1 |
| epollInFinally(ChannelConfig) |  | 0% |  | 0% | 6 | 6 | 6 | 6 | 1 | 1 |
| executeEpollInReadyRunnable(ChannelConfig) |  | 0% |  | 0% | 4 | 4 | 5 | 5 | 1 | 1 |
| clearEpollRdHup() |  | 0% | | n/a | 1 | 1 | 6 | 6 | 1 | 1 |
| epollRdHupReady() |  | 0% |  | 0% | 2 | 2 | 6 | 6 | 1 | 1 |
| epollOutReady() |  | 0% |  | 0% | 3 | 3 | 5 | 5 | 1 | 1 |
| AbstractEpollChannel.AbstractEpollUnsafe(AbstractEpollChannel) |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|
| recvBufAllocHandle() |  | 0% |  | 0% | 2 | 2 | 3 | 3 | 1 | 1 |
| fireEventAndClose(Object) |  | 0% | | n/a | 1 | 1 | 3 | 3 | 1 | 1 |
| fulfillConnectPromise(ChannelPromise, Throwable) |  | 0% |  | 0% | 2 | 2 | 5 | 5 | 1 | 1 |
| flush0() |  | 0% |  | 0% | 2 | 2 | 3 | 3 | 1 | 1 |
| static {...} |  | 0% |  | 0% | 2 | 2 | 1 | 1 | 1 | 1 |
| newEpollHandle(RecvByteBufAllocator.ExtendedHandle) |  | 0% | | n/a | 1 | 1 | 1 | 1 | 1 | 1 |
| epollInBefore() |  | 0% | | n/a | 1 | 1 | 2 | 2 | 1 | 1 |